About The Position

GPJ is hiring a Creative Project Coordinator to join their growing team. This role is hybrid, requiring on-site presence in Los Angeles or San Francisco a minimum of 2 days per week. The coordinator is responsible for managing communication between the creative team and internal partners, advocating for the creative team by removing obstacles, assisting with timeline creation and management, and trafficking creative projects from request to completion. They will work closely with creative resourcing and Creative Directors to ensure appropriate staffing, manage project dashboards and status documents, and establish new tools when needed. The role involves coordinating and attending internal briefings and reviews, capturing notes, tracking down assets, following up with other departments for information, setting up creative folders and Slack channels, and flagging process issues to Creative Operations for solutions.
